Someone beat and robbed a 58-year-old man Sunday night in the Loop.

The man was hit in the head and kicked during the robbery about 10:40 p.m. in the 200 block of West Adams Street, according to Chicago police. The male suspect ran away with the his backpack.

The victim was taken to Northwestern Memorial Hospital, where his condition was stabilized.

No one is in custody as Area Central detectives investigate.
